Wolf Down

2 locals recommend,

Unique things to do nearby

Photoshoot at Photogenic Spots in Ottawa
Sightseeing Bike Tour of Ottawa
Cycle Canada's Capital
Location
380 Bank Street
Ottawa, ON
Centretown